How they compare

Norway currently reports 55,533 kg of oil equivalent per capita against 52,941 kg of oil equivalent per capita in Luxembourg, a difference of 2,592 kg of oil equivalent per capita.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 35 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Luxembourg ahead.

Luxembourg ranks 19th and Norway ranks 16th of 174 countries.

Luxembourg has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Luxembourg Norway Difference Ahead
1990s 96,229 kg of oil equivalent per capita 62,423 kg of oil equivalent per capita 33,806 kg of oil equivalent per capita Luxembourg
2000s 99,755 kg of oil equivalent per capita 70,438 kg of oil equivalent per capita 29,317 kg of oil equivalent per capita Luxembourg
2010s 81,780 kg of oil equivalent per capita 65,207 kg of oil equivalent per capita 16,573 kg of oil equivalent per capita Luxembourg
2020s 58,323 kg of oil equivalent per capita 57,582 kg of oil equivalent per capita 741.22 kg of oil equivalent per capita Luxembourg

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
